During major festivals like Eid-ul-Fitr, Eid-ul-Adha, and Durga Puja, Bangladeshi TV channels and YouTube networks release hundreds of single-episode dramas (Natoks) and celebrity talk shows. Repack platforms clip together the funniest scenes, romantic highlights, or intense emotional climaxes, creating viral sensations overnight. Rural and Urban Lifestyle Vlogging
